- 2
- 0
- 约3.1万字
- 约 47页
- 2026-04-23 发布于江西
- 举报
金融科技与区块链技术应用手册
第1章
区块链基础架构与核心原理
第一节分布式账本机制与共识算法详解
1.1分布式账本机制与节点共识
分布式账本(DLT)是指所有参与者共享同一份数据结构的账本,任何交易都必须经过全网验证才能被记录,确保数据的一致性。在比特币网络中,当矿工成功打包一笔交易时,该交易会被广播给全网节点,而非仅由矿工自己确认,每一台计算机都拥有完整的账本副本。节点共识是解决“谁有权决定账本更新”的核心机制,通过数学算法防止恶意节点篡改历史数据。例如,在PoS(工作量证明)机制中,节点通过质押质押的代币来换取记账权,只有持有足够代币且运行合法程序的节点才能参与出块。
共识算法决定了网络中节点如何达成对账本状态的同一性。在PoW机制下,矿工必须解决复杂的数学难题(如寻找2^256的质数因子)才能新区块,只有第一个解决者才能将交易打包并广播给网络。节点类型包括矿工节点(Miner)、验证节点(Validator)、普通用户节点(User)和交易所节点(Exchange),它们根据角色分工协作。矿工负责发现交易并打包,验证节点负责验证交易逻辑和签名,普通用户节点仅用于接收和发送交易,交易所节点则负责撮合交易和资金清算。数据复制机制确保即使部分节点宕机,网络也不会瘫痪。每个节点都会从网络中随机选取其他节点的数据副本进行,形成冗余存储,这样当某个节点故障时
原创力文档

文档评论(0)